Aidan Guilfoyle, April 27, 2018April 27, 2018 Apr 26, 2018; Arlington, TX, USA; A general view of the front of the stadium before the NFL Draft at AT&T Stadium. Mandatory Credit: Tim Heitman-USA TODAY Sports ORG XMIT: USATSI-379258 ORIG FILE ID: 20180426_jla_sh2_010.jpg